Here's the plan for Octobers SDRuby

INDEXING: THE SECOND PILLAR OF DATABASE DESIGN.
Guyren Howe will discuss how to design the most effective indexes for your
application.

ACCEPTANCE TESTING YOUR APPLICATION
Hillary Hueter will give us some practical guidance on acceptance testing
any application. The focus will be on best practices and tools for creating
a useful and productive Acceptance Test Suite.

FINDING YOUR PROGRAMMING LEARNING STYLE
Rob Kaufman will talk about how different people learn programming topics
and give some tips for each of the common styles. We'll also talk briefly
about how to find the mix of techniques that is right for you.
